1994 Mazda 626 vs. 1978 Peugeot 504
To start off, 1994 Mazda 626 is newer by 16 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 1978 Peugeot 504.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 1978 Peugeot 504 would be higher. At 1,991 cc (4 cylinders), 1994 Mazda 626 is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 1994 Mazda 626 (108 HP @ 5300 RPM) has 17 more horse power than 1978 Peugeot 504. (91 HP @ 5200 RPM). In normal driving conditions, 1994 Mazda 626 should accelerate faster than 1978 Peugeot 504.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 1978 Peugeot 504 weights approximately 110 kg more than 1994 Mazda 626.
Let's talk about torque, 1994 Mazda 626 (167 Nm @ 4500 RPM) has 7 more torque (in Nm) than 1978 Peugeot 504. (160 Nm @ 3000 RPM). This means 1994 Mazda 626 will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 1978 Peugeot 504.
Compare all specifications:
1994 Mazda 626 | 1978 Peugeot 504 | |
Make | Mazda | Peugeot |
Model | 626 | 504 |
Year Released | 1994 | 1978 |
Engine Position | Front | Front |
Engine Size | 1991 cc | 1971 cc |
Engine Cylinders | 4 cylinders | 4 cylinders |
Engine Type | in-line | in-line |
Horse Power | 108 HP | 91 HP |
Engine RPM | 5300 RPM | 5200 RPM |
Torque | 167 Nm | 160 Nm |
Torque RPM | 4500 RPM | 3000 RPM |
Engine Bore Size | 80 mm | 88 mm |
Engine Stroke Size | 98 mm | 81 mm |
Fuel Type | Gasoline | Gasoline |
Number of Seats | 5 seats | 5 seats |
Vehicle Weight | 1220 kg | 1330 kg |
Vehicle Length | 4600 mm | 4810 mm |
Vehicle Width | 1700 mm | 1700 mm |
Vehicle Height | 1440 mm | 1560 mm |
Wheelbase Size | 2620 mm | 2910 mm |
